QNST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2020 in Review
148 of the 4,877 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in QuinStreet (QNST) for Q2 2020, worth a combined $466M — up 25% from $374M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 22 funds closed out of QNST and 16 opened new positions — a net loss of 6 holders — while 46 trimmed existing stakes and 63 added.
The largest buyer was William Blair Investment Management, adding an estimated $7.19M. The largest seller was Victory Capital Management, cutting an estimated $18.3M.
